#2f5180 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2f5180 is composed of 18.4% red, 31.8%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 63.3% cyan, 36.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 214.8 degrees, a saturation of 46.3% and a lightness of 34.3%. #2f5180 color hex could be obtained by blending #5ea2ff with #000001.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#2f5180

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#05080d is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#2f5180

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#575758 is the less saturated color, while #074ba8 is the most saturated one.
